According to the regulations of the “Polish Deal”, VAT groups could be established as early as July this year. However, the Ministry of Finance proposed to postpone the date of entry into force of the provisions relating to VAT Groups to January 1, 2023. Moreover, the Ministry of Finance also proposed a change in the field of records to be kept by members of the VAT Group. These changes were introduced in the Act on the Automation of Certain Matters Handling by the National Revenue Administration, which is currently in the Senate (print no. 701). During the meeting on May 17, 2022, the Senate Legislative Office raised constitutional reservations about the procedure for introducing the above-mentioned regulations. Therefore, the Senators refrained from taking a decision to amend the provisions on VAT Groups until the government presents its position at the plenary session of the Senate.
